    Batwoman » Batwoman #18 - This Blood is Thick: Secrets released by DC Comics on May 2013.

    Short summary describing this issue.

    No recent wiki edits to this page.

    A new story arc begins here as Batwoman adjusts to her new partner and her new role in the war on crime.

    Guest-starring Batman!
